A Yucca Valley man was arrested Wednesday (June 2) accused of armed robbery following an investigation into a stolen vehicle. According to Sheriff’s reports, deputies responded to a report of a robbery at the Sinclair Gas Station in 55000 block of Twentynine Palms Highway in Yucca Valley on Tuesday, May 25, around 11 a.m. An unidentified Hispanic mal suspect had entered the business with a silver semi-automatic style handgun and demanded money from the station attendant at gunpoint. The suspect took an undisclosed amount of money then fled the scene on foot traveling northwest. Deputies launched an immediate area search with the help of Sheriff’s Aviation, but the suspect was not located.

Officials seeking volunteers to help care for seized horses in Helena

The Lewis and Clark County Sheriff s Office put out a call for volunteers to help care for the nearly 60 horses seized from a north Helena Valley ranch Tuesday amid an investigation into alleged neglect.  Sheriff Leo Dutton said a Cascade County horse rescue operation took in 10 of the horses, including a few of the studs, mares and foals. They were problematic horses, Dutton said of the three studs that were making caring for the rest of the herd difficult. The studs are not well behaved. Researchers: Rare bee s range includes Ocala National Forest

Finding them in the Ocala National Forest First described in 2011, the blue calamintha bee, Osmia calaminthae, was known from only four locations on Lake Wales Ridge until museum researcher Chase Kimmel documented new populations in 2020. Over the past two field seasons, Kimmel and field technician Clint Gibson have observed the bee at 11 new locations, including the Ocala National Forest, giving scientists valuable insight into the species’ potential range.  The bee’s primary home, Lake Wales Ridge, is a 150-mile-long sandy spine running down the center of the state, the remnant of ancient islands in Florida’s distant past. The region harbors plant and animal species found nowhere else, but ranks among the nation’s fastest-disappearing ecosystems, with pockets of natural habitat surrounded by citrus groves and suburban neighborhoods.
